Steve Koudelka

  • Class
    1993
  • Induction
    2006
  • Sport(s)
    Men's Lacrosse
As a dominant and steady force in goal, Koudelka helped propel the Bullets’ men’s lacrosse program to national prominence. A two-time All-American, Koudelka led the team to Middle Atlantic Conference (MAC) championships and NCAA tournament appearances in all three seasons that he was the starting goalkeeper.

As the backstop for three trips to the NCAA tournament, which were the first three of 12 consecutive berths from 1991-2002, Koudelka put his name in the school record book. His 1992 saves total of 193 was fifth-highest in Gettysburg history at the time. That mark is still eighth at the time of his induction. He also graduated with the sixth-most saves in school history with 510, a number which is still seventh in 2006.

His stellar play earned him individual honors. He was a three-time first-team MAC All-Star, the conference's most valuable player in 1993 and was a second-team All-American in both 1992 and 1993.

He played every game as a sophomore, junior and senior compiling a 33-9 overall record.

A native of Tallahassee, Fla., he graduated from Gettysburg in 1993 with a degree in health and physical education.
